Transaction 93250be94fccf40f8638343de136e27871119d3b16384c82d0628cbd578e624e
1 Input
1 Output
-
93250be94fccf40f8638343de136e27871119d3b16384c82d0628cbd578e624e:0
- value
- 626693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ef5366ff2c33ede44708eba34305fe2caddc29fe OP_EQUAL
- address
- 3PWTLHazHHQYdf6u5r6TgiNY2MedExXn5U